In November 2025, a breathtaking spectacle will unfold at Kennedy Space Center’s Launch Pad 39A, where the Griffin lunar lander, propelled by the formidable power of SpaceX’s Falcon Heavy, will surge into the heavens, heralding a monumental cool triumph in humanity’s quest to reclaim the Moon. This hallowed site, once the crucible for Apollo’s visionary voyages and the solemn stage of the Challenger crew’s final moments, stands poised to etch a transformative chapter in space exploration. Crafted by Astrobotic under NASA’s Commercial Lunar Payload Services (CLPS) initiative, Griffin will carry the VIPER rover, entrusted with the staggering mission of probing lunar water and charting resources vital for our cosmic destiny. NASA’s CLPS initiative, embodied by Griffin, will redefine space exploration with a model that radiates profound cool potential in its simplicity and speed. Through partnerships with private trailblazers like Astrobotic, a dynamic force from Pittsburgh, NASA will transcend the bureaucratic quagmires of yesteryear, fostering a nimble, targeted strategy for technological evolution. Though not without risks—two other CLPS missions faced delays or failures—Griffin’s anticipated victory is set to galvanize the program’s credibility, proving commercial entities can propel us beyond low-Earth orbit. SpaceX will provide the formidable launch prowess, Astrobotic the spacecraft, and NASA the scientific vision, creating a synergy that realizes ambitions once confined to the resources of entire nations.
